Yakult And Peanut Butter Bites

Description

Cooking Time

Preparation Time :5 Min

Cook Time : 8 Hr 0 Min

Total Time : 8 Hr 5 Min

Ingredients

Serves : 6
  • 1 bottle Yakult


  • 1/2 Frozen banana


  • 1 1/2 tbsp Peanut Butter

Directions

  • Freeze a small banana or half of a big banana. (I always have frozen bananas in my freezer for innumerable dessert ideas. These come in handy whenever you need them)
  • Add the frozen banana pieces in a blender jar. Add the frozen banana pieces in a blender jar along with Yakult and Peanut butter.
  • Blend until smooth. Note: There is absolutely no need of adding sugar to it. It tastes just right due to the ripe and frozen Bananas.
  • Add a tablespoon of this mix into silicone moulds and freeze until set (preferably overnight. Grease the moulds with a little melted butter for a perfect non messy job).
  • Serve immediately when out of the freezer and keep the remaining if any in the freezer only. Though I doubt if any of them would remain. That's how good these bites taste. Enjoy!
  • Please note: The number of bites would depend on the size of the mould. Just keep a tab of the ratio of using 1 bottle of yakult to half frozen banana and multiply it according to your need/requirement.
